O'Neal Dirt Bike Boot, New Logo, men
Dirt bike boot with injection molded plastic plates and a metal shank for protection and support. Four-buckle closure and air mesh interior enhance comfort and fit; customers note good value and protection with roomy toebox
Pros
- protective injection molded plates
- metal shank for structure and support
- four-buckle snap-lock closure
- air mesh interior for comfort
Cons
- buckles reported to break by some users
- boots can be very stiff and hard to shift
O'NEAL Element Dirt Bike Boots
Dirt bike boots with a metal shank, toe guard and heat shield for protection. Comfortable with padding for long rides and supportive for feet and ankles, though some users note stiffness and strap wear over time
Pros
- metal shank insert reinforces boot shape
- snap-lock adjustable four buckle closure
- metal toe guard protects sole
- synthetic leather heat shield guards against heat
Cons
- straps breaking off reported by some users
- many describe boots as very stiff
- mixed feedback on durability
